n1-08: Current Detection Method
No.
(Hex.)
Name Description
Default
(Range)
n1-08
(1105)
Expert
Current Detection Method
Sets how the drive decreases the motor vibration that is caused by leakage current. Usually it is
not necessary to change this parameter.
0
(0, 1)
0 : 2-Phases
1 : 3-Phases
Note:
Set this parameter to 1 to suppress motor vibrations caused by leakage current when the wiring distance is long.
n1-13: DC Bus Stabilization Control
No.
(Hex.)
Name Description
Default
(Range)
n1-13
(1B59)
Expert
DC Bus Stabilization
Control
Sets the oscillation suppression function for the DC bus voltage.
0
(0, 1)
0 : Disabled
1 : Enabled
Note:
If the DC bus voltage does not become stable with light loads and the drive detects ov [Overvoltage], set this parameter to 1.
n1-14: DC Bus Stabilization Time
No.
(Hex.)
Name Description
Default
(Range)
n1-14
(1B5A)
Expert
DC Bus Stabilization Time
Adjusts the responsiveness of the oscillation suppression function for the DC bus voltage. Set n1-
13 = 1 [DC Bus Stabilization Control = Enabled] to enable this parameter.
100.0 ms
(50.0 - 500.0 ms)
Note:
Adjust this parameter in 100 ms increments.
n1-15: PWM Voltage Offset Calibration
No.
(Hex.)
Name Description
Default
(Range)
n1-15
(0BF8)
Expert
PWM Voltage Offset
Calibration
Sets the calibration method that the drive uses to decrease torque/current ripple.
Determined by A1-02
(0 - 2)
This calibration function lets the drive suppress the torque ripple of a motor. Usually it is not necessary to change
this setting.
0 : No Calibration
1 : One Time Calibrate at Next Start
2 : Calibrate Every Time at Start
